Twitter won't block world leaders
Twitter has reiterated its stance that accounts belonging to world leaders have special status on the social media network, pushing back against users who want it to banish US President Donald Trump.

New light on Native American origins
An 11,000-year-old skeleton of two children, unearthed in Alaska, is yet another part of the story of where Native Americans come form.

No US ambassador for Australia called insulting
A former Australian deputy prime minister says the USA is perpetuating a diplomatic insult to his country by failing to appoint an ambassador to Canberra. Audio

Californians get recreational marijuana for 2018
Californians will be able to have a very chilled out New Year's Day, when recreational marijuana is legalised.

California fire now larger than New York
The most destructive wildfire raging in southern California has expanded significantly, scorching an area larger than New York City.
